1.1.1 运维人员的重要职责有哪些
1.数据不泄露不丢失 2.7*24小时不宕机 3.优化用户体验
1.2 绝对路径与相对路径概念和区别是什么?
1.绝对路径:以根开始的路径 2.不以根开始的路径
1.3 简述进程、守护进程、程序之间的区别
程序是存放在电脑上的代码文件,存储于磁盘。
进程是正在运行的程序,存储于内存里,在内存里执行
守护进程 为了处理一项任务或者提供服务而持续运行的
1.4 写出你所知道的主流Linux系统发行版本(5种以上)
麒麟 红旗 CentOS Red Hat Fedora Ubuntu
1.5 请描述GNU、GPL名词含义和内容?
GNU:GNU is not Unix 革奴计划,目的是开发一项完全自由的和可移植的类Unix的操作系统
GPL:通用公共许可 保证任何人有共享修改自由软件的自由,任何人有权取得,修改发布自由软件的权利,但必须同时给出具体更改的源代码
[if !supportLists]1.6[endif]请描述命令行提示符的各组成部分含义?
Root @ oldboy ~ #
当前用户名 分隔符 主机名 当前用户所在目录 提示符
1.7.Linux系统中网卡配置文件的地址是____,让指定程序开机自启需要再哪个文件设置_____,开机自动挂载的文件是_______,DNS客户端的文件地址是______。
Vi/etc/sysconfig/network-scripts/ifcfg-eth0 网卡配置文件 rc.local开机自启
Fstab 自动挂载 resolvconf DNS客户端文件地址
1.8 在/tmp中创建oldboy目录,并在其中创建oldgirl.txt文件
[if !supportLists]a. [endif]在oldgirl.txt文件中键入“oldboyedu”(不少于三种方法)
1.vim oldgirl.txt i :wq
2.echo “oldboyedu” > /oldgirl.txt
3.cat ./oldboy/oldgirl
b.通过一条命令将下面内容输入到girl.txt中:
oldboyedu
oldgirl
linux
答:cat./oldbiy/girl.txt
oldboyedu
oldgirl
linux
[if !supportLists]b.[endif]打印出oldgirl.txt文件中包含oldboyedu的所有行
Grep “oldboyedu” ./oldbou/oldgirl.txt
1.9 已知/etc/目录为Linux默认配置文件及服务启动命令目录,请做如下题目:
[if !supportLists]a. [endif]请用tar 打包/etc 整个目录(打包及压缩)
tar zcf /etc/etc.tar.gz /etc
[if !supportLists]b. [endif]请把a 中的压缩包,解压到/tmp 指定目录下(最好只用tar 命令实现)
tar zxf /etc/etc.tar.gz –C /tmp
1.10.请写出你所知道的命令行模式下及vim模式中常用的快捷键(各至少5种以上)
ctrl + c cancel 取消当前的操作
ctrl + l (
小写字母L) clear(命令)清空屏幕并在顶行新开一行命令行
ctrl + d
退出当前用户
ctrl + r
查找(历史命令)。history|grep
ctrl + a
把光标移动到行首
ctrl + e
把光标移动到行尾
[if !supportLineBreakNewLine]
[endif]
1.11.新建文件num.txt 在其中键入1-30数字序列,并显示数字10-20的序列
seq 30 >num.txt grep 10 -A 10num.txt
1.12 实际生产环境中常见的分区方式有哪几种,分别怎样分区的
普通分区
/boot 引导分区256M
Swap 交换分区 内存大于8G,给8G,小于8G,给到内存的1.5倍
/ 给所有空间
(2)存储服务器(含数据库)的分区方式:
/boot 引导分区256M
swap 交换分区 内存大于8G,给8G。内存小于8G,给到1.5倍的内存。
/ 给100G
/data 剩余给数据分区 ,data可以是任意名称
(3)门户网站的分区方案
/boot 引导分区256M
swap 交换分区 内存大于8G,给8G。内存小于8G,给到1.5倍的内存。
/ 给100G
剩余保留,将来哪个部门使用,使用部门自己分剩余的分区。
1.13Raid0和raid1的特点与区别
Ride0---把多块盘合成一块盘,可用容量是所有盘之和。
没有冗余,即坏一块盘,整个RAID就坏,数据都会丢失。
性能是所有盘之和优点
RAID1---只能是两块盘整合到一起,容量还是一块盘容量。
冗余100%,即坏一块数据不丢失,性能减半,只是一块盘性能。
1.14 Centos6中开机启动的流程
1.开机BIOS检
2.加载MBR引导程序
3.加载GRUB菜单选择不同内核(单用户)
4.加载内核Kernel
5.运行INIT进程
6.读取/etc/inittab文件(设定运行级别)
7.读取/etc/rc.d/sysinit (初始化系统)
8.读取/etc/init/rc.conf文件(执行/etc/rc.d/rc 3运行级别脚本)
9.读取/etc/rc.local文件(设定开机自启动程序)
10.读取/etc/init/tty.conf文件(启动mingetty 3进程 -----显示login界面)
1.15 简述Centos6系统中的七种运行级别
0 关机
1单用户
2多用户
3文本模式 ,命令行模式
4 未启用
5 图形桌面模式
6 重启
通过这次考试,我认识到了自己的不足,以为这些基础不重要,后来才知道,我错了,正如老男孩老师那句话:基础不牢,地动山摇!!! 对一些命令还是不熟悉。